MIRRORS by Ada Tsesmeli Edwards comes to New York
The internationally acclaimed theatrical play MIRRORS, written by Ada Tsesmeli Edwards , arrives in New York for a limited series of performances at Newtown Stage in Astoria.
Following a powerful journey across Greece, where it captivated audiences through a series of sold-out performances, MIRRORS now opens a new chapter , bringing its deeply human narrative to an international audience.
Blending poetic English language with raw realism, MIRRORS explores themes of domestic violence, identity, memory, and the silent fractures that shape human relationships.
Through a sequence of monologues and theatrical compositions, the performance creates a hauntingly intimate space where the audience is invited not only to observe but to reflect.
